StatPro North America Successfully completes 
SAS70 Type I Audit

In 2009, StatPro North America successfully completed a SAS 70 Type I audit of our hosted software suite and market data provision services.  During this audit we underwent a review of our control objectives and activities to ensure that the proper safeguards are in place for hosting or processing data that belongs to our customers.  A Type I audit involved the auditor evaluating our defined and documented controls and procedures, on a selected single business day, as they related to our hosted services.

Since completing the Type I audit, we have undergone significant changes in our hosted environment, most specifically around the addition of a large number of clients and move to a new Data Center.

In 2011, StatPro will undergo a Statement on Standards for Attestation Engagements (SSAE) No. 16, audit (which is a new North American standard that replaces SAS 70 Type II audits as of June 15th, 2011).  This audit will evaluate StatPro's documented control activities and procedures over a 6 month period January, 1, 2011 to June 30, 2011.

The scope of the Type II audit includes:

  • Physical and Environmental Security
  • Backup and Recovery
  • Processing and Scheduling
  • OS, DB, network and application security
  • Change Management
  • Data Transmissions Processing

Undertaking a SSAE 16 audit represents StatPro’s continued commitment to evaluating and improving our hosted clients’ data and software control environment.  It is our hope that the extensive SSAE No. 16 audit assures our clients that the timely, business critical services that we provide are governed and in compliance with the guidelines defined by the audit.
